YOUR VOICES AND COMMUNITY INPUT ARE INVITED!

Join Rice+Lipka Architects and Starr Whitehouse Landscape Architects for a community conversation and presentation to rethink public waterfront access to Summit Lake, including new landscape, playground, and community center.

Dense forest of trees in full bloom over their reflection in a body of water with growth floating on the surface. White text overlaying.

The community-based conversation will include:

  • Looking at a taped-out footprint for the proposed new Community Center location
  • Design stations with post-it notes speech bubbles for comments and stars for rating
  • Physical site topo models
  • Large printout of issues lists for each site
  • Key images from the project design presentation
  • Precedent grid of images for walkways, water access, and parking
  • Large aerial photos of sites with “game” pieces for real-time test & photos of different arrangements
